Genetics counselors are health care professionals who have specialized education and training in the field of medical genetics. Using family history, a genetic counselor will assess individual or family risk of an inherited condition, such as a genetic disorder or a birth defect. 


Genetic counselors educate patients and professionals about genetic diseases and genetic testing options. They also advise patients on the social and ethical issues associated with a genetic disorder or a genetic test result and help patients cope with a diagnosis of a genetic disease.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ct genetic risk assessments and evaluate family histories to identify potential genetic conditions. 
  • Provide clear and accurate information about genetic testing options and their implications.
  • Support patients in understanding test results and their impact on health and family planning.
  • Offer emotional support and counseling to individuals and families facing genetic concerns.
  • Collaborate with healthcare providers to integrate genetic information into patient care.
  • Stay informed about advancements in genetics and genetic testing technologies.
  • Maintain detailed and confidential patient records.
  • Educate patients and the community about genetic conditions and preventive measures.
Qualifications

Basic Requirements/Certifications:

  • Candidates must be board certified or eligible for certification by the American Board of Genetic Counseling. 
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ification. 

Education Required:  

  • Bachelor’s degree in biology, social sciences, or another related field. 
  • Master of Science degree from an accredited graduate program in genetic counseling.
